Can't Access Meta Business Suite
Meta Business Suite won't let you in — it loads to the wrong account, shows none of your Pages, or throws a permission error. Here is how to find which of the usual causes you're hitting before assuming anything is broken.
Trouble getting into Meta Business Suite is almost always one of a few things: you are signed into a different Facebook profile than the one with access, the Business Portfolio you expect is not the one tied to your account, your assets were never assigned to you so the dashboard looks empty, or a recent change has not finished propagating. None of those mean your access is gone — they mean Business Suite is showing you a context that does not contain what you are looking for.

Symptom / cause
Identify your exact symptom first — the fix differs for each.
| What you’re seeing | Likely cause | What it usually means |
|---|---|---|
| Business Suite opens to the wrong account or portfolio | A different Facebook profile is the active login | Business Suite shows the context of whoever is signed in; switch accounts. |
| It loads but is completely empty | You are in a portfolio with no assets assigned to you | You have a seat but no Pages were assigned — an assignment issue, not a login one. |
| You get a permission or access-denied error | Your role was changed or removed, or you are in the wrong portfolio | The account may no longer have the access it once did, or never had it here. |
| The expected portfolio is not in the switcher | You were never added, or added under a different account | Your current login is not a member of that portfolio. |
| It worked yesterday and now shows nothing | A removal, role change, or propagation delay | Someone may have changed access, or a recent change is still settling. |
If Business Suite will not load at all — blank, spinning, or a sign-in loop — that is a browser or session issue. Try a private window with only the correct account signed in.
Step-by-step: get into the right context
Follow these in order. Most cases resolve at step 1 or 2.
Confirm which Facebook account is signed in
Open a private or incognito window and sign into Facebook with only the account that has access — nothing else. Then go to business.facebook.com. This rules out account-switching confusion.
Where: business.facebook.com in a private window
Confirm: Business Suite opens against the account you intended.
Check the portfolio switcher
Once in, look for the Business Portfolio switcher. If the portfolio you expect is not listed, your current account is not a member of it — and you need an admin to add the right account, or you need to sign in with the account that is already a member.
Where: Meta Business Suite → portfolio switcher
Confirm: The expected portfolio appears in the switcher.
Confirm assets were assigned, not just membership
If you are in the right portfolio but it is empty, ask the admin to confirm that Pages and other assets are actually assigned to you under Settings → People. Membership alone shows nothing.
Where: Meta Business Suite → Settings → People
Confirm: Your assigned Pages and assets appear in the dashboard.

Allow a few minutes for recent changes
If access was just granted or changed, give it a few minutes and reload. Community experience is that changes are not always instant across Meta's surfaces. If it has been much longer, treat it as a membership or assignment issue rather than a delay.
